LA Mart Design Center showrooms to exhibit fine furnishings, accessories lines at prestigious Dwell on Design LA show, June 24-26

The LA Mart Design Center, Southern California’s singular, comprehensive source for designer and custom-manufactured furniture and accessories, has teamed with Dwell on Design LA, (DODLA) the U.S.A.’s largest design event, to present the West Coast’s wide-ranging designer, retailer and consumer communities a preview of the expansive selection of furniture and accessories brands represented at the LA Mart’s long-standing and rapidly growing Design Center (LAMDC). The unprecedented event, open to both the trade and to consumers, including all furniture, home accents, and lifestyle enthusiasts, will highlight innovative, on-trend LAMDC merchandise in a 400 square foot booth that creates a design-driven, modern “Loft” environment and “outdoor” space. The Dwell on Design LA show will take place June 24 through June 26, 2016, 10 a.m. to 6 p.m. at the Los Angeles Convention Center.

“We are delighted to have our Design Center’s tenants participate in the Dwell On Design LA event for the first time. This exciting opportunity to partner in such an important, cutting-edge design show marks the beginning of a truly dynamic alliance with DODLA which will lead to unique and unparalleled collaborations between us starting in 2017,” said Frank Joens, sr. vice president and general manager.

The imaginative LAMDC lifestyle booth at the Dwell on Design LA show will be curated, designed and created by well-known Los Angeles-based designer Maria Videla-Juniel, owner and curator of The Art of Room Design in La Canada Flintridge, CA. Ms. Videla-Juniel was the winning designer on HGTV’s popular Designer’s Challenge television show, as well as being chosen to execute outstanding living spaces as one of the elite designers invited to originate and create rooms in and unprecedented six Pasadena Showcase Houses. Her award-winning work has also been featured in Better Homes & Gardens, as well as “Best of Houzz” designed for the international professional design community.

The LA Mart Design Center is the home for over 30 fine furniture, decorative accessories, lighting, rug, wallpaper, garden products and textile-oriented showrooms that represent 500+ leading lines in the design industry.

Supported by the editors of the highly respected publication, the annual Dwell on Design Show, known at the “largest design event in the United States,” serves the professional interior design community, architects, landscape experts and design enthusiasts, showcasing over 2,000 imaginative, on-trend furnishings and home products as well as ground-breaking new design technologies in a three-day exhibition open to the trade only on the first day, and to the public for the remainder of the show.

The collaboration between the LAMDC and DODLA marks the very first time that the event has partnered with any permanent trade mart in its Los Angeles location.
